What Is Himalayan Pink Rock Salt?
Himalayan pink rock salt is a naturally occurring rock salt that is mined from underground salt deposits. It is naturally occurring salt that has a characteristic pink colour due to trace minerals and compounds found in the salt. Rock salt is considered to be less processed than table salt. It can come in a range of textures, from larger crystals to a fine powder that is easy to cook with. It has a mild and balanced taste that allows it to be used in many different dishes.
Naturally Occurring Minerals
The mineral content is one of the reasons this Himalayan pink salt is so popular. It may include naturally occurring minerals like calcium, magnesium, potassium and iron, which give it its color and content. These minerals, however, occur in low concentrations. Himalayan pink salt is thus not a significant source of essential minerals. It is used as a food salt, predominantly for sodium, similar to other edible salts.
Why Sodium Still Matters
Sodium is an essential mineral required by the body. It is involved in healthy muscle function, fluid balance and nerve function. However, eating excessive amounts of sodium can also pose health risks. So, whether you select Himalayan Pink Salt or sendha namak or table salt, it's important to practice moderation. It is important to embrace the choice of a naturally sourced salt for its taste, texture and culinary properties, rather than the idea that it can be used in unlimited quantities.
